10 Times WWE Wrestlers Weren’t Acting: Real Emotions and Genuine Reactions

**Introduction**
In the world of WWE, scripted drama and real-life emotions often blend, creating unforgettable moments where wrestlers’ true feelings shine through. Here are ten times WWE wrestlers weren’t acting, proving that sometimes reality hits harder than the storyline.

**Number 10: Paul Heyman’s Shoot Promo (2001)**
Paul Heyman, celebrated as one of wrestling’s greatest talkers, delivered an unscripted promo in late 2001 that stunned fans. Leading up to Survivor Series, Heyman unleashed a passionate tirade against Vince McMahon, which was raw and real. Heyman later recounted that McMahon encouraged him to “draw money,” resulting in a promo that boosted interest in the event and showcased Heyman’s unmatched mic skills.

**Number 9: A Precursor to The Attitude Era (1995)**
In 1995, WWE was still finding its footing, despite a star-studded roster. After losing the WWE title to Bret Hart, Diesel delivered a shoot promo on Raw, expressing genuine frustration and referencing Vince McMahon as the company owner—a rare move at the time. This promo, filled with real emotions, is seen as an early indicator of the edgy themes that would define the Attitude Era.

**Number 8: Hulk Hogan’s Legitimate Anger (2014)**
During Hulk Hogan’s birthday celebration in 2014, Brock Lesnar went off script, calling Hogan “grandpa” on live TV. Hogan’s seething reaction was genuine, later confirmed in an interview where he expressed anger over Lesnar’s comment, particularly in front of his family. This unscripted moment added an extra layer of drama to the segment.

**Number 7: Macho Man’s Real Pain**
In a notorious ’90s segment, Jake Roberts’ snake attacked Randy Savage. While scripted, the snake’s bite inflicted real pain, leading to genuine anguish from Savage. The situation worsened when Savage developed a staph infection, which he mistakenly blamed on the snake. This incident is a prime example of the dangerous reality behind some wrestling stunts.

**Number 6: Seth Rollins’ Anguish at WrestleMania 40 (2024)**
In April 2024, Seth Rollins underwent meniscus surgery but still competed at WrestleMania 40. Rollins’ performances were top-tier despite the excruciating pain. Rewatching the event, his injury becomes evident, particularly in how he executed his moves and struggled to walk—a testament to his dedication and resilience.

**Number 5: Bret Hart’s Shoot Promo (1997)**
Bret Hart, known for his in-ring prowess, delivered a shoot promo in 1997, blurring lines between fiction and reality. Expressing real frustrations on Raw, Hart’s promo is often seen as the unofficial start of the Attitude Era. His genuine emotions made the segment impactful and memorable.

**Number 4: The Undertaker’s Genuine Annoyance (2019)**
The dream match between The Undertaker and Goldberg in 2019 turned disastrous due to multiple botches. After the match, The Undertaker’s visible disgust and exhaustion were real, reflecting his disappointment. He later distanced himself from the match, acknowledging its near-catastrophic outcome.

**Number 3: Joey Styles’ Shoot Promo on WWE (2006)**
When Joey Styles transitioned to the revamped ECW brand, he delivered a shoot promo on Raw, criticizing WWE’s product and hypocrisy. Styles’ raw honesty highlighted issues within the company, making this one of the most memorable promos of the Ruthless Aggression Era.

**Number 2: The Miz Snaps on Talking Smack (2016)**
Talking Smack allowed WWE talent more freedom in their promos. The Miz’s shoot on Daniel Bryan in 2016 is legendary, driven by real-life animosity. His intense, unscripted outburst elevated his character and the Intercontinental title, making the segment unforgettable.

**Number 1: Paul Heyman’s Dedication (2018)**
To enhance a storyline in 2018, Paul Heyman stayed up all night before an interview to appear genuinely distressed about Brock Lesnar turning on him. Heyman’s bloodshot eyes and authentic turmoil added depth to the storyline, showcasing his commitment to his craft.
